purefb_s3user – Create or delete FlashBlade Object Store account users
New in version 2.8.
Synopsis
- Create or delete object store account users on a Pure Storage FlashBlade.
Requirements
The below requirements are needed on the host that executes this module.
- python >= 2.7
- purity_fb >= 1.1
Parameters
Parameter | Choices/Defaults | Comments |
---|---|---|
access_key
boolean
|
|
Create secret access key.
Key can be exposed using the debug module
|
account
string
|
The name of object store account associated with user
|
|
api_token
string
|
FlashBlade API token for admin privileged user.
|
|
fb_url
string
|
FlashBlade management IP address or Hostname.
|
|
name
string
|
The name of object store user
|
|
state
string
|
|
Create or delete object store account user

Notes
Note
- This module requires the
purity_fb
Python library - You must set
PUREFB_URL
andPUREFB_API
environment variables if fb_url and api_token arguments are not passed to the module directly
Examples
- name: Create object store user (with access ID and key) foo in account bar
purefb_s3user:
name: foo
account: bar
fb_url: 10.10.10.2
api_token: e31060a7-21fc-e277-6240-25983c6c4592
debug:
var: ansible_facts.fb_s3user
- name: Delete object store user foo in account bar
purefb_s3user:
name: foo
account: bar
state: absent
fb_url: 10.10.10.2
api_token: e31060a7-21fc-e277-6240-25983c6c4592
